2012-03-29 76 views
0

我有一系列.NET WCF RESTFul服務可以產生JSON或XML格式的響應。這些服務將被android java客戶端使用。我目前是一個android/java新手。我應該使用JSON還是XML?

哪種格式更容易處理。哪個更快。

由於他們是我自己的服務,我不太在乎類型安全。 謝謝, 加里

回答

1

JSON通常稍微輕一點,所以如果帶寬是一個問題(鑑於你的目標是Android設備,很可能),我會說JSON。另外,如果您想在Web瀏覽器中開放JavaScript服務,JS(和JS開發人員)可能會更樂意接收JSON。

XML是很好,我想,如果你想使用模式或如果你正在做JAXB的東西或東西。

2

我覺得這兩天都變得相當標準。我想有一個贊成JSON的觀點是它不那麼冗長。然而,在另一方面,大多數開發人員似乎仍然更喜歡xml。

+0

這也是一個問題,你可以在你使用的框架中得到更好的支持 – TGH 2012-03-29 00:20:20

1

JSON更具可讀性,更易於維護。我已經使用了兩者,並且在大多數情況下我更喜歡JSON。這取決於你,哪一個更適合你。

+0

可讀性對於JSON(至少在我看來)是一個很好的觀點,很好的調用!另外,如果我的答案中含糊不清,我傾向於傾向於使用JSON。 – JKing 2012-03-29 00:25:08

相關問題